  7. Hi, You could try this. Run GameEx via a batch (.bat) file, that on exit runs myHTPC. Hopefully when myHTPC is run at the end it will regain focus. Most modern HTPC software regains focus or maximizes with this method. It works for Sage. Create c:\runit.bat ----------------------- C: CD "\Program files\GameEx" GameEx.exe C: CD "\Program files\Myhtpc" myhtpc.exe Tell myHTPC to run the batch file above instead of GameEx.exe Let me know how it works out. If not you could write an autoit script to do this fairly easily I would have thought. Thanks, Tom

  23. OK. 1. Make sure your running the latest version of GameEx 4.07. If not install it. 2. If that does not fix it goto 3:) 3. Open My Computer or Windows Explorer 4. Navigate to C:\program files\GameEx\Data 5. Delete 'Gamelist.txt' 6. Run GameEx 7. Update List again.
